Differences Between Camco Circuit Analyzers and Power Defenders  

Question:

After reviewing one of your answers, the difference between the 55301 and 55312 is that the 55301 automatically resets if the voltage falls above or below and theres a surge. The 55312 does not protect against the low or high voltages but would protect against a large power surge. If it does detect and protect against a large power surge, it CAN be manually reset or its a one time protection like a fuse?

0

Expert Reply:

You are correct. The 30 Camco RV Power Defender Voltage Protector # CAM55301 is like a circuit breaker and automatically resets if there's a surge whereas the 50 amp Circuit Analyzer part # CAM55313 is like a fuse and it only can handle one surge.

For a 50 amp breaker style you'd need the part # CAM55306.
